Definition Assisted Negotiation - a form of mediation whereby the parties work informally with a neutral third party to develop a separation agreement.
Application in Divorce Assisted negotiation includes a variety of avenues divorcing parties may use to achieve a settlement and thus avoid litigation. With the help of a third party to ease tension and introduce options, many spouses are capable of reaching an agreement that is mutually beneficial to all those involved.

  1. Divorce is a Deal
    Divorce is a business deal with three salient considerations. They are: 1. The allocation of assets and liabilities. 2. Spousal support, if any. 3. Custody and support of children, if any.
  2. A Better View
    It is often said that spouses negotiating their own settlement are too deep in the forest to see beyond the trees. A third party to shine a little light on a divorce situation may lead to a quicker settlement with less emotional trauma with minimal legal fees.
  3. Negotiate with a written plan with alternatives.
    Be proactive: (1) Be clear on the issue by stating an overall statement of the situation in one sentence; (2) gather any needed facts and be sure of their accuracy -- never assume; (3) write out three plans -- one you would like to see happen and two more that you can live with so you have options; (4) be able to articulate why each solution would be of benefit to not only you, but others involved (5) when you feel confident that your facts are correct and your solutions make sense, approach the other and ask for a time to meet to see if the issue can be resolve.
